Archer he/him Posted October 22, 2022 Author Posted October 22, 2022 GM Thoughts: -Shining, Wiz, and Mark sent one or two PMs per round, but no one else did. I banked on lower levels of PM safety making the need for an elim scanner low, but I think everyone got scared off by the PM rule. Which was interesting because people with even/odd roles could have gone crazy in their off cycles. The PM rule would have been really hard to keep track of if PMs were busier though, so I’d caution future GMs against it. Instead, I’d suggest a hard cap (eg 10) and have players self-police. (Shoutout to Mark for counting his own PMs!) -I’m glad Araris convinced me to name the range of dates available instead of keeping it secret. The range was big enough that it still would have been special if someone had hit it, which was the goal of the exercise. I probably wouldn’t run the mechanic again because even if someone had gotten their date right, it was a small reward for a large-ish amount of work. Alternatively, I would have played hotter-colder or higher-lower or had a cooperative element. The optimal elim strategy would have been for the person submitting an action every round (Devo) to submit the kill every round too, which would free up both of Illwei’s actions for coin guessing every time, maximizing their odds of getting it. -Shoutout to Xino who watched over Conq every single round. There was a time when Devo had submitted a roleblock on Conq that he would have seen, but it was changed to Sil I think. -There was also an almost-interaction of Devo roleblocking Sil and killing Mat(?) and Sil protecting the kill target- but they’d have been roleblocked from doing so, oo la la! But order changes scuttled that too. -By the way, the elim roleblocker was a trap role because there was a good chance they’d get caught by all the scanners. The village protection and elim self-protection being both Odd was also on purpose, to give Illwei the chance to frame Sil if they suspiciously survived a round. All the vote manip being village was also a trap for meta-gamers. -Surprisingly, based on how the game came down to an elim blunder and getting to a cycle away from 1v1, I think it was pretty balanced. I agree that that C3 late rollover really helped the village by giving them the chance to back off a mix, so that needs to be considered. It was partially balanced by the commonness of people failing to get their actions in on time. I expected people to paranoidly submit their actions as early in the cycle as they could, but what happened instead was a bunch of non-submissions. Same with voting. People were more lax than I expected about the deadline, so its use as a motivational mechanic has its limits. -I liked that variable rollover times gave me schedule flexibility as a GM. I recommend them for future use. -Organizing your player list by the OOA is a good idea. -Thanks to everyone who complimented the writeups. An unexpected plot emerged and I just rolled with it. There’s an Easter egg in the Gaston one where the police chief says he can’t read and that points to the wording of the protection role Sil had about them having influential connections in the police department that keep them safe. -Again, thank you all for playing.
